Edge AI Chips Market Forecast to Reach $291.8 Billion by 2033 Driven by Decentralized Intelligence

The AI Journal· June 19, 2026

The global edge artificial intelligence (AI) chips market is projected to grow from $27.3 billion in 2025 to $291.8 billion by 2033, representing a significant compound annual growth rate of 34.7%. This rapid expansion is fueled by a strategic shift toward decentralized intelligence, where AI processing occurs directly on devices rather than relying solely on cloud infrastructure. For the semiconductor industry, this transition signifies a massive surge in demand for specialized hardware capable of delivering low-latency, high-efficiency performance across consumer and enterprise sectors.

According to industry analysis from Grand View Research, the move toward edge computing is driven by the need for faster processing speeds, enhanced privacy, and reduced bandwidth requirements. By placing AI algorithms closer to the data source, organizations can achieve real-time decision-making in critical applications such as autonomous vehicles, industrial automation, and healthcare systems. This shift is particularly vital for mission-critical operations where even milliseconds of latency can impact performance or safety, necessitating a fundamental change in how semiconductor firms design and deploy processing power.

In terms of hardware architecture, central processing units (CPUs) currently maintain a leadership position due to their versatility in handling both sequential and parallel workloads. However, application-specific integrated circuits (ASICs) are identified as the fastest-growing category, with an expected CAGR of 33.2% through 2033. ASICs are increasingly favored for their ability to execute specific AI tasks with superior power efficiency and lower latency compared to general-purpose processors, making them ideal for custom silicon architectures in robotics, advanced healthcare diagnostics, and smart infrastructure.

Consumer electronics, including smartphones, wearables, and smart home systems, remained the largest market segment in 2025 as manufacturers integrate AI for voice recognition, image processing, and personalized recommendations. Looking ahead, enterprise adoption is expected to gain significant momentum as businesses leverage edge AI to improve operational efficiency, strengthen cybersecurity, and address data sovereignty concerns. This broad adoption across sectors like telecommunications and manufacturing is creating a sustained growth engine for the global semiconductor industry as organizations move away from traditional cloud-centric architectures.
